JAGUAR XJ-S/XJS
PRICE RANGE £600-16,000
Six-cylinder models are refined but the V12 offers greater refinement than anything from Crewe or Stuttgart. It’s still supreme value for money – even the V12 convertible – although values of fine examples are thrusting ahead. Late six-pot cars (and coupés in particular) offer the best value. A drop, then, but still deservedly in the top ten.
